Fast Food and Counter Workers Salary in Michigan
The median annual wage for fast food and counter workers in Michigan is $28,930 ($13.91 per hour) — -7.3% vs. the national median of $31,200. Source: BLS OEWS, May 2025 estimates.
- Median annual wage
- $28,930
- Mean annual wage
- $30,260
- Median hourly wage
- $13.91
- Employment in MI
- 103,130
103,130 employed · 23.4 per 1,000 jobs
Wage percentiles in Michigan
| Percentile | Annual wage | Hourly wage |
|---|---|---|
| 10th percentile | $25,960 | $12.48 |
| 25th percentile | $27,580 | $13.26 |
| Median (50th) | $28,930 | $13.91 |
| 75th percentile | $32,760 | $15.75 |
| 90th percentile | $35,970 | $17.29 |
What this salary is worth in Michigan
- Cost-of-living adjusted salary
- $30,067
- Median rent burden
- 46.8%
- Est. affordable home price
- $105,535
Michigan prices are 96.2 vs. U.S. average = 100 (BEA RPP, 2024)
Median gross rent in Michigan: $1,129/mo (ACS 2020-2024). 30% of income = $723/mo
At 6.67% 30-yr rate (FRED, 2026-08), 20% down, 28% front-end DTI, 1.5%/yr taxes+insurance
For context, the median home value in Michigan is $231,600 (ACS 2020-2024).
